About the Opportunity

Our client, a growing real estate investment and property management company in Miami, is seeking a Staff Accountant with Yardi experience to join its Accounting team. This role is ideal for an accounting professional with experience supporting commercial, multifamily, or mixed-use real estate portfolios. The Staff Accountant will be responsible for maintaining accurate financial records, preparing monthly financial statements, performing account reconciliations, and supporting month-end close for multiple properties.

Key Responsibilities

  • Prepare monthly journal entries and maintain the general ledger for an assigned portfolio of properties.
  • Perform month-end and year-end closing activities, ensuring accurate and timely financial reporting.
  • Prepare monthly financial statements, including balance sheets, income statements, and supporting schedules.
  • Reconcile bank accounts, balance sheet accounts, tenant security deposits, and intercompany transactions.
  • Review accounts payable and accounts receivable activity to ensure proper coding and accuracy.
  • Prepare and analyze monthly budget-to-actual variances and assist with financial reporting packages.
  • Maintain accurate tenant ledgers, CAM reconciliations, and rent roll reporting.
  • Record accruals, prepaid expenses, depreciation, and other recurring journal entries.
  • Assist with annual budgets, audits, and tax support schedules.
  • Support acquisitions, dispositions, and property transitions as needed.
  • Ensure compliance with GAAP and company accounting policies.
  • Work closely with Property Managers, Asset Managers, and other internal departments to resolve accounting issues.
  • Assist with process improvements and special accounting projects.
